The Drake Group Letter to U.S. Dept. of Education/Office for Civil Rights — Request for Issuance of Title IX Guidance Addressing Recruiting Practices of NIL Booster Collectives

The Drake Group believes that the current NIL chaos can be relieved by DOE/OCR clearly and precisely warning institutions, their conferences, and national governance organizations of their obligations under existing Title IX requirements, explaining how those requirements apply to these new NIL-related activities, and warning that actions by “NIL booster collectives” will be attributed to the universities when appropriate. The Drake Group Examines 2023 Congressional Efforts to Alleviate the College Athlete NIL Chaos

Representatives of the NCAA, prominent athletic conferences, and athletics administrators have been pacing the halls of Congress asking their Senators and Representatives for federal laws that would negate the patchwork of state laws that gave college athletes name, image, and likeness employment rights outside their education institutions.
